ホーム
用語集
ダンクシャーディング

ダンクシャーディング

中級者
ダンクシャーディングは、Ethereum 2.0(Serenity)アップグレードの一部であるEthereum Cancunアップグレードで最も重要となる機能の1つです。ダンクシャーディングは、画期的なシャーディングアーキテクチャであり、Ethereumネットワーク内のデータ管理とトランザクション処理を最適化するものです。

ダンクシャーディングとは

Ethereumの研究者であるDankrad Feistの名前に由来するダンクシャーディングは、シャーディング技術に斬新な手法を導入するものです。シャーディングとは、ブロックチェーンデータベースを扱いやすくするためより小さくすることで、効率を高めるものです。従来のシャーディング手法とは異なり、ダンクシャーディングはアーキテクチャを単純化しており、データ保管とトランザクション処理の手数料を統合し、同じバリデーターに支払う「統合市場手数料」のコンセプトを実装しています。
従来のシャーディングでは、各シャードには個別のブロックとブロック提案者が存在します。ダンクシャーディングは、ブロック提案者を1つにすることでこれを合理化し、トランザクション処理とデータ保存の効率を向上させます。このイノベーションは、セキュリティ、分散化、スケーラビリティに対応し、ブロックチェーンのトリレンマに対応できます。

Dankshardingの主な機能

1. 統合市場手数料(Merged market fee:):ダンクシャーディングは、統合市場手数料を導入し、複数のブロック提案者が関与する複雑さの排除、データ保管とトランザクション処理の手数料の統合、トランザクション処理を合理化を実現します。

2. データ可用性の最適化:ダンクシャーディングは、イーサリアム上のレイヤー2スケーリングソリューションであるロールアップのデータ可用性を高めることを主な目的としています。データを効率的に管理することで、ダンクシャーディングはネットワークのパフォーマンスを大幅に向上させます。

3. シャーディングアーキテクチャの簡素化:ダンクシャーディングは、シャーディング構造を簡素化し、より簡単で効率的なものにします。このアプローチは、従来のトリレンマがもたらす課題に対処し、セキュリティ、分散化、スケーラビリティのバランスを改善します。

プロト・ダンクシャーディング:飛躍への準備

プロト・ダンクシャーディングは、ダンクシャーディングの完全な実装に先立つ暫定的なソリューションとして、重要な橋渡しになります。ダンクシャーディングが最終的な目標であることに変わりはないものの、プロト・ダンクシャーディングはガス代の削減やスケーラビリティの向上といった直接的なメリットをもたらします。

ダンクシャーディングがEthereumに与える影響

ダンクシャーディングの実装は、スケーラビリティの懸念に対応し、データ管理を最適化し、Ethereumに新時代をもたらすことになるでしょう。Ethereumネットワークはトランザクション量が大幅に増加し、ユーザーにとっても開発者にとってもより利用しやすくなります。

Ethereumの開発が進展するにつれて、ダンクシャーディングはプラットフォーム改善をめざす中核的な技術として登場しました。その影響力はトランザクション処理にとどまらず、より広範なEthereumエコシステムに影響を与え、より堅牢でスケーラブルなブロックチェーンの未来を約束するものです。